ISO 15614-7:2007 specifies how a preliminary welding procedure specification for overlay welding is qualified by welding procedure tests.
ISO 15614-7:2007 defines the conditions for carrying out welding procedure tests and the range of qualification for welding procedures for all practical welding operations within the range of variables listed in Clause 8.
Additional tests may be required by application standards.
ISO 15614-7:2007 applies to all welding processes suitable for overlay welding.
ISO 15614-7:2007 is applicable to all new welding procedures. However, it does not invalidate previous welding procedure tests made to former national standards or specifications. Where additional tests are carried out to make the qualification technically equivalent, they are only done on a test piece made in accordance with ISO 15614-7:2007.
ISO 15614-7:2007 does not apply to overlay welding where cracks are intentionally produced (e.g. special hardfacing applications).

3 Terms and definitions
For the purposes of this document, the terms and definitions given in ISO/TR 25901 apply.
4 Preliminary welding procedure specification (pWPS)
4.1 Overlay welding
The pWPS shall be in accordance with ISO 15609-1, ISO 15609-3 and ISO 15609-4. It shall specify the
tolerances for all the relevant parameters.
The welding procedure shall be qualified in accordance with Clauses 5 to 8.
4.2 Hardfacing
The pWPS shall be in accordance with ISO 15609-1, ISO 15609-2, ISO 15609-3 and ISO 15609-4. It shall
specify the tolerances for all the relevant parameters.
The welding procedure shall be qualified in accordance with Clauses 5 to 8.

1) To be published (revision of CEN/TR 14599).
2 © ISO 2007 – All rights reserved

ISO 15614-7:2007(E)
4.3 Building-up
The pWPS shall be in accordance with ISO 15609-1. It shall specify the tolerances for all the relevant
parameters.
The welding procedure shall be qualified in accordance with ISO 15613 or ISO 15614-1 and Clauses 5 to 8.
4.4 Buttering
The pWPS shall be in accordance with ISO 15609-1. It shall specify the tolerances for all the relevant
parameters.
If buttering is used for welding between dissimilar materials, the welding procedure shall be qualified in
accordance with ISO 15614-1.
If buttering is used to produce a metallurgically compatible weld metal between the parent material and
overlay welding or hardfacing, the welding procedure shall be qualified in accordance with ISO 15614-1 and
Clauses 5 to 8.
5 Welding procedure test
A test piece shall be welded using the same welding processes as the ones to be used in production
(e.g. strip overlay welding + manual metal arc overlay welding with covered electrode).
The welding and testing of test pieces shall be in accordance with Clauses 6 and 7.
6 Test piece
6.1 Shape and dimensions of test pieces
6.1.1 General
The welding procedure test shall be carried out on standardized test piece(s) in accordance with Figures 1
and 2, and 6.2. Parent material(s) shall be used which represent the material(s) to be welded in production.
The dimensions and/or number of test pieces shall be sufficient to allow all required tests to be carried out
(see Figures 1 and 2).
The thickness and/or diameter of the test pieces shall be selected in accordance with the range of qualification.
6.1.2 Overlay welding and hardfacing
A minimum of three beads for the last layer is required.
6.1.3 Buffer layer
If a buffer layer is used in production welding, it shall be used in welding the test piece.

6.2 Welding of test pieces
Preparation and welding of test pieces shall be carried out in accordance with the pWPS and under the
general conditions in production that they shall represent.
Welding and testing of the test pieces shall be witnessed by an examiner or an examining body.
